fix(call-to-play): resync after live delivery failure

A failed fire-and-forget event left one peer's active call state divergent until
some later discovery or reconnect happened. During a LAN party that could leave
different players looking at different rosters or chat.

Fall back to the existing bidirectional handshake whenever a live Call to Play
send fails. Its active-history exchange heals both sides immediately when the
failure was transient. Document the related wall-clock synchronization
assumption for deadline and countdown presentation.
